Its been a busy time in the coaching world with capital Football finalising courses at the B-Diploma and C-Diploma levels as well as a Foundation of Football course as the next generation of coaching talent continues to develop.
Ten coaches took part in the he Foundation of Football course, hosted by Canberra Croatia, a course aimed at volunteer parents and coaches working with advanced beginner to competent level players or players aged up to approximately fifteen years old.
Coaches participated in practical sessions covering the basics of techniques as well as learning about basic playing principles of the game, undertaken a level that is a prerequisite for the Football Australia/AFC C Diploma.
A group of twenty coaches recently completed their C-Diploma, aimed at coaches working with advanced beginner to competent level players, whilst a similar sized group completed their B-Diploma, the next step on the coaching pathway.
Capital Football Coaching Courses aim to increase the coach’s knowledge and develop skills in the preparation, organisation, and administration of safe, age-related training sessions. Each course was hosted by Phil Booth, Capital Football’s Technical Director.
